DMSO Production and Logistics Functional Working Group workshop. Proceedings held in McLean, VA on 16-18 Nov 1992
Abstract
During 1992, a series of workshops was conducted in support of the Defense Modeling and Simulation Office (DMSO) to determine the modeling and simulation (M&S needs of the defense M&S community. This community is partitioned into five major areas: Education, Training and Military Operations (ETMO), Research and Development (R&D), Test and Evaluation (T&E), Production and Logistics (P&L), and Analysis. Each of these areas has a Functional Working Group (FWG) representing its interests to the DMSO and other interested parties. Workshops were conducted to assist the FWGs in determining the requirements pull to be considered in the development of the DMSO Master Plan. This report presents the results of the Productions and Logistics Workshop in developing Modeling and Simulation needs for the P&L community. The executive summary provides an overview of the background, objectives, methodology, and organization of the workshop, and presents a summary of key findings of the workshop. The body presents the workshop background and objectives, describes the working groups and workshop process, and presents the results of the three- day workshop....
